Orchard Fest 2025
The orchard Trust Day Service Upper Stowfield, Lower Lydbrook, GloucestershireORCHARD FEST 2025: TICKETS NOW ON SALE! The Orchard Trust is proud to present ORCHARDFEST 2025 – Our first ever accessible music festival designed especially for people with learning disabilities, where everyone is welcome! There will be live music, food vans, a bar, walkabout entertainment, and much more! Come and join in […]
£30